California's economy surpasses Japan's, yet faces budget deficits and financial woes in major cities.
California has become the world's fourth-largest economy, surpassing Japan with a GDP of $4.1 trillion.
Despite this, the state faces a structural budget deficit and financial struggles in major cities like Los Angeles and San Francisco due to overspending and mismanagement.
Governor Gavin Newsom warns that President Trump's tariffs could worsen the situation, leading to higher costs and potential layoffs.
